Why choose this course

Our Bridge Engineering MSc is the only masters programme in this area in Europe – and one of the very few around the world. Running since the early 1970s, our fully accredited course provides you with the opportunity to develop your knowledge and skills in specialist aspects of bridge engineering, including very recent erection methods for accelerated bridge construction (ABC).

You’ll be taught by passionate academics with exceptional expertise in bridge-related research and practice, alongside guest lecturers from industry within the field of bridge engineering and management.

This MSc will help you pursue an exciting career as a bridge engineer with a consultancy, specialist contractor or local authority.

Our programme is also fully aligned with the Sustainable Development Goals of the United Nations, and it puts emphasis on sustainability and resilience in civil engineering infrastructure design and assessment.

What you will study

Our MSc in Bridge Engineering is designed to provide you with a solid understanding of bridge analysis, design and management. If you’re a practising bridge engineer, it will enable you to update your existing knowledge and skills, and familiarise yourself with new industry-relevant techniques.

This course covers a wide range of modules that address the whole life-analysis of bridges from design through to end-of-life. You’ll also have a choice of optional modules from the areas of:

  • Construction management
  • Geotechnical engineering
  • Infrastructure engineering and management
  • Structural engineering
  • Water/environmental engineering.

Entry requirements

A minimum of a 2:2 UK honours degree in civil engineering (or other related engineering subjects), or equivalent recognised international degree.
